[0013] The present invention is described in detail as follows in conjunction with accompanying drawing:

[0014] The waste plastic oil refining process of the present invention is as follows: first, waste oil with a total weight of 20% of waste plastic is added to the first-stage catalytic cracking kettle (2) through the waste oil inlet pipe (18), and then the waste plastic is crushed to 30 cm Below, the screw feeder (1) is added to the primary catalytic cracking tank (2) below 250°C for stirring; in the second step, the temperature in the primary catalytic cracking tank (2) is gradually increased from 250°C to 450°C , add a catalyzer by catalyst inlet pipe (18) in 15~20 minutes, after the HCL in the kettle is removed HCL by the chemical dechlorination agent in dechlorination tank (19), enter secondary catalytic cracking reactor (3 ); in the third step, the temperature rise in the secondary catalytic cracking reactor (3) is controlled between 380 DEG C and 400 DEG C, and the ...

Abstract

The present invention discloses an oil refining process and equipment with waste plastic. Inside an industrial furnace painted with far infrared material to increase radiation heat by 20 %, there are the first or horizontal catalytic cracking reactor and hating space around it. The catalytically cracking produced oil gas is deeply cracked and recombined in the second catalytic cracking reactor and fractionized, condensed and oil-water separated. The separated gasoline and diesel oil are fed to storage tanks separately, heavy oil is returned to the furnace for refining for the second time, the light hydrocarbon gas is backed to the furnace for burning, and the coke slag produced in catalytic cracking is exhausted via spiral slag drainer. The present invention can change waste plastic into qualified gasoline or diesel oil product.
